Leonardo AW139

The Leonardo AW139 is one of the most popular medium twin-engine helicopters in operation today.

The AW139’s flexible design makes it a very capable platform for offshore oil & gas support, VIP transportation, medical evacuation and other utility flying tasks.

The AW139 can carry up to 15 passengers and can cruise at up to 165 knots (190mph) for up to five hours. It has two Pratt & Whitney PT6A-67C engines, producing 1,679 shp each.

The AW139 is constructed with energy-absorbing landing gear, fuselage and seats all designed to meet the rigorous JAR / FAR 29 standards. The aircraft also has a state of the art fully glass cockpit and full digital electronic engine control (FADEC) to minimise pilot workload.

Leonardo AW139 Specs:

Engines: 2 PT6A-67C engines

Max continuous power: 1,679SHP

Pilot(s): 2

Passengers: Up to 15

WEIGHT: Maximum gross weight: 6,400 kg

SPEED AND ENDURANCE:

Cruise Speed: 165kts

Max. endurance at Max weight (no reserve): 5 hours 13 minutes

Max Range, no reserves: 573 NM
